| Stargate fans are sure to be excited by some major revelations regarding Jack's somewhat shrouded educational past. From these photographs, we can see clearly that Jack O'Neill graduated the [http://www.stargate-sg1-solutions.com/wg/jo_office/020_academy_certificate.html United States Air Force Academy] as a 2nd Lieutenant in the Class of 1974. His certificate was awarded in recognition of his academic excellence in military science and engineering.

| Jack also has a certificate of training from the Joint Special Operations Warfare Center for his successful completion of the [http://www.stargate-sg1-solutions.com/wg/jo_office/021_special_ops.html Air Commando Operations Course] and the achievement of honor graduate in the class of 92-03.

| Finally, we see a commendation from the [http://www.stargate-sg1-solutions.com/wg/jo_office/024_certificate.html United States Air Force Space Systems Command] in recognition of his excellence of achievement while conducting special operations under auspices of Space Systems Command.
